Sluggish Spot Transactions During the Week; Focus on Consumption Next Week [SMM Shanghai Spot Weekly Review]

SMM News, Mar 13: Shanghai spot premiums weakened this week, with the weekly average price down 20 yuan/mt WoW. As of Friday this week, ordinary domestic brands were quoted at discounts of 100-90 yuan/mt against the 2604 contract, while the high-priced brand Shuangyan was quoted at a discount of 30 yuan/mt against the 2604 contract. Shanghai zinc ingot social inventory continued to accumulate this week, and market traders actively offered cargoes for sale, but SHFE zinc prices fluctuated in a consolidating range. Downstream enterprises had built up some inventory by buying the dip last week, overall spot consumption remained weak, and market transactions were relatively sluggish during the week. Spot discounts continued to widen, and attention should be paid to the recovery of consumption next week.

[SHFE/LME zinc price ratio pulled back to around 6.9 and oscillated]: This week, the SHFE/LME zinc price ratio pulled back to around 6.9 and oscillated, with the zinc ingot import window remaining closed. Outside China, there were frequent fundamental disruptions: Peru issued an energy emergency decree, Kazakhstan's Zazzinc reduced operations at its lead-zinc mine following an accident, and Peru's Cajamarquilla zinc smelter was shut down due to a fire. Tight supply sentiment intensified, and LME zinc pulled back slightly after surging to a three-year high.
